On average Viking has average deprivation and low crime levels, with around 52 crimes per 1,000 residents per year, about 38% below the South East average of 84 per 1,000. Approximately 4.3% of homes in this area are social housing provided by a local council or housing association. The average income per household in Viking is £51,018 per year. There are 3 schools in Viking: 3 primary (2 Outstanding and 0 Good) and 0 secondary (0 Outstanding and 0 Good). Viking is home to around 7,268 people, with a population density of about 3,527.1 per km².
Based on 89 recent sales, the median property price is £395,000 (about £367 per square foot) in Viking area, with individual transactions ranging from £120,000 up to £870,000.

Viking records about 52 crimes per 1,000 residents per year, which is a low crime rate for England: it scores 3 out of 10 on the Area360 crime scale, where 10 is the highest crime level.
The median sale price in Viking is £395,000 (about £367 per square foot) based on 89 registered sales according to HM Land Registry data.
Viking has 3 primary schools (2 rated Outstanding). Ratings are from the latest Ofsted inspections.
Viking scores 5 out of 10 on the deprivation scale, where 10 is the most deprived. The typical neighbourhood in Viking sits around rank 19,740 of 32,844 in England on the official Index of Multiple Deprivation (rank 1 is the most deprived).
The average household income in Viking is around £51,018 per year, and 4% of homes are social housing (ONS data).
Viking is represented by 3 elected councillors: John Nichols (Conservative and Unionist Party), Kristian Matthew Bright (Labour Party) and Roopa Raman Farooki (Labour Party).
